Transaction 6617a7506af945c35a97bd4120ca2fc5cff267f2bf5eed4e6a57de423bedfd48
1 Input
1 Output
-
6617a7506af945c35a97bd4120ca2fc5cff267f2bf5eed4e6a57de423bedfd48:0
- value
- 594986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 195d2249a9fc62c140397d086c2a4b14295866aa OP_EQUAL
- address
- 3418PQ63qLaofqBrUEaR38nupDRcXJLdCq